| Abstract | Since its inception at the University of McMaster (Canada), Problem Based Learning (PBL) was conceived as an appropriate methodology for the health science education. The use of this methodology has grown over the years. The PBL favors the acquisition of communication skills, critical thinking and teamwork and increases motivation in students. One of the main characteristics of this system is that a health care problem serves as stimulus and guide to student learning which provide students with a reality-centered learning that they will face in the real world of work. This intervention proposal is intended for the Module Promotion of Health and Psychological Support to the Patient, of the Training Cycle of the Intermediate Degree of Technician in Auxiliary Nursing Care (TCAE). Focusing on the psychosocial care of the oncological patient, given that the WHO estimates that the incidence figures of this disease will increase in the short and medium term. Therefore, it is necessary for the TCAE to be taught in communication skills that provide humanized attention to patients with cancer. The aim of this Final Master's Project is to suggest an intervention proposal for psychosocial care for cancer patients using an active methodology that achieves significant learning in students, increasing their motivation. Looking as a result, that the future TCAE can humanize the care they provide to cancer patients. |
